Matlab在一些非常专业的领域,暂时还是无可替代的,比如能源行业,之前我有呆过,研究电池的模型还是会用到Matlab,还有一些很贵的仪器上面都是运行的专业版的Matlab,这件事情交给Python就不一定能完成。术业有专攻这句话用在工具上面还是能说得通,大学的时候有接触过数学建模,也就是用数学模型来解决实际生活中的问题,就是用的Matlab,后来也有专门的专业课程,学习了Matlab的使用,给我
转载
2023-10-18 06:37:35
165阅读
# 数学建模大赛:Python与MATLAB的选择
随着科技的迅速发展,数学建模已成为一项重要的技能。在数学建模大赛中,选手需要运用数学知识、计算机编程和领域知识解决实际问题。在这方面,Python与MATLAB都是常用的工具。那么,参加数学建模大赛是否需要学习这两种语言呢?本文将探讨这个问题,并提供一些代码示例和实际应用场景。
## 数学建模简介
数学建模是将实际问题转化为数学形式,通过数
abs(x):純量的絕對值或向量的長度angle(z):複數z的相角(Phase angle)sqrt(x):開平方real(z):複數z的實部imag(z):複數z的虛部conj(z):複數z的共軛複數round(x):四捨五入至最近整數fix(x):無論正負,捨去小數至最近整數 向0取整floor(x):地板函數,即捨去正小數至最近整數ceil(x):天花板函數,即加入正小數至最近整數rat(
转载
2009-01-02 11:18:00
95阅读
2评论
一、python简介python是一种面向对象的解释型计算机程序设计语言。python是纯粹的自由软件,源代码和解释器CPython遵循GPL协议。Python语法简介清晰,特色之一是强制用空白符作为语句缩进python执行python在执行时,首先会将.py文件中的源代码编译成Python的byte code(字节码),然后再由Python Virtual Machine(python虚拟机)来
转载
2023-06-29 16:17:11
228阅读
在无风情况下的喷泉模拟
我的python代码
import numpy as np
import random
import matplotlib
matplotlib.rcParams['font.sans-serif']=[u'simHei']
matplotlib.rcParams['axes.unicode_minus']=False
import matplotlib.pyplot a
原创
2021-08-30 15:17:09
390阅读
指派授课问题
现有A、B、C、D四门课程,需由甲、乙、丙、丁四人讲授,并且规定:
每人只讲且必须讲1门课;每门课必须且只需1人讲。
四人分别讲每门课的费用示于表中:
课
费用
人
A
B
C
D
甲
2
10
9
7
乙
15
4
14
8
丙
13
14
16
11
丁
4
15
13
9
带
原创
2021-09-02 10:13:09
449阅读
指派授课问题
现有A、B、C、D四门课程,需由甲、乙、丙、丁四人讲授,并且规定:
每人只讲且必须讲1门课;每门课必须且只需1人讲。
四人分别讲每门课的费用示于表中:
课
费用
人
A
B
C
D
甲
2
10
9
7
乙
15
4
14
8
丙
13
14
16
11
丁
4
15
13
9
原创
2021-09-08 14:55:18
320阅读
费了几天功夫,终于将Python科学计算工具winpython给熟悉了个大概,基本满足自己的需要了。费话不多说,马上讲解决一下为什么python如此让人着迷:1.下载Python的IDE发行版有很多,不过,最常用的是winpython,它轻巧,包含了常用的科学计算工具包numpy,scipy,sklearn,matplotlib,还有可以调用C动态库的扩展包ctypes,更好的是它有32位和64位
转载
2023-12-22 13:42:22
40阅读
在做数据分析中,常用的3个主流软件Matlab、R、python究竟哪个更好用呢,在地学、遥感、GIS领域3个软件各有优势,可以互补:1、Matlab最擅长的是矩阵计算,不管你是什么格式的文件,matlab都把他先矩阵化再做运算,个人认为遥感领域的栅格处理计算在matlab最为简单方便;但是Matlab作图不好看,问题较多,不能输出矢量文件(尤其是空间图,会自动降低分辨率)。也不易用它来处理矢量s
转载
2023-06-20 15:38:42
266阅读
本文作者是一位机器学习工程师,他比较了四种机器学习编程语言(工具):R、Python、MATLAB 和 OCTAVE。作者列出了这些语言(工具)的优缺点,希望对想开始学习它们的人有用。图源:Pixabay.comGitHub 地址:https://github.com/mjbahmani/10-steps-to-become-a-data-scientistR 语言R 是一种用于统计计算和图的语言
转载
2024-09-06 10:52:29
45阅读
MATLAB是一款数值和矩阵计算软件,兼有强大的时域系统以及电力仿真Simulink模块,这使得MATLAB在工程领域有着难以取代的地位。不过受限于面向过程的开发逻辑,较大的体积和繁琐的安装、破解流程,以及正版昂贵的特性,加之并不太活跃的官方以及社区支持,对于普通用户和数据分析用户,以及开发项目的纯程序员一直不友好,MATLAB在编程语言界的地位也一直不太高,且有逐年下降的趋势。相比之下,Pyth
转载
2023-08-21 11:11:05
10阅读
1.问题概述2.单个样本t检验2.1问题分析2.2matlab代码2.3结果分析3.配对样本t检验3.1问题分析3.2代码求解3.3结果分析4.独立样本t检验4.1问题分析4.2代码求解4.3结果分析4.3结果分析
支持:Windows®, Linux®, Mac 如何从 MATLAB® 函数创建 Python® 包并将生成的包集成到 Python 应用程序中。 1.确认安装了与 MATLAB Compiler SDK™ 兼容的 Python 版本。 2.最终用户必须安装 MATLAB Runtime 才能运行应用程序。MATLAB Runtime 是一套独立的共享库,可以执行已编译的 MATLAB 应用程序
转载
2024-02-13 11:41:40
48阅读
python+NumPy+Scipy+matplotlib 约等于 matlab=======================================现在学术界越来越多人使用Python 语言取代Matlab作为研究的主要程序编写工具。python语言看似有点类似matlab语言,对于习惯Matlab的使用者来说,转换到Python语言应该并不困难,但是有些关键要注意的地方,也就是这两种语
转载
2023-07-04 13:42:43
162阅读
MATLAB 在数据可视化、数据分析以及数值计算方面的巨大优势,使其在高校科学研究以及企业产品研发中具有不可或缺的作用。相比之下,伴随人工智能的发展,Python因更易学、拥有众多开源科学计算库等特点成为语言学习者的新宠。那么,如何在MATLAB中调用Python命令或文件,如何综合利用MATLAB和Python更加轻易地完成各种高级任务呢?目前,MATLAB支持2.7、3.6和3.7版本Pyth
转载
2023-12-08 19:03:16
36阅读
例12:一只游船上有800(1000)人,一名游客不慎患传染病,12(10)小时后有3人发病,由于船上不能及时隔离,问经过60(30)小时,72小时,患此病的人数。(与人口模型和Logistic模型类似)
先用python和matlab模拟
我的python代码
# -*- coding: utf-8 -*-
import numpy as np
import random
import mat
原创
2021-09-08 14:55:14
411阅读
例12:一只游船上有800(1000)人,一名游客不慎患传染病,12(10)小时后有3人发病,由于船上不能及时隔离,问经过60(30)小时,72小时,患此病的人数。(与人口模型和Logistic模型类似)
先用python和matlab模拟
我的python代码
# -*- coding: utf-8 -*-
import numpy as np
import random
import ma
原创
2021-08-30 15:17:39
773阅读